Does weightlifting(lower body wise) affect how fast your pace is? Bc I currently 14 months PP and I’ve been trying to improve my mileage time but I’m stuck at the 8:40 and up mark 🥲 and I conclude it’s due to weightlifting. I do my cardio afterwards but I give myself hours to recover before going for a run
@abbypollock
@abbypollock 24 күн бұрын
It can, but usually due to its effects on recovery. As a general rule of thumb - I keep my weights and runs on separate days or put my priority session first 💛 if that still doesn’t help, maybe consider decreasing weightlifting volume.
